The study by Dewi Puspaningtyas Faeni examines the impact of Green Human Resources Management (GHRM) policies and knowledge on the environmental performance of employees in the public transportation sector. Using data from 1130 respondents, the research employs SmartPLS modeling to analyze the mediating roles of GHRM policies and knowledge. The findings indicate that GHRM significantly affects the environmental performance of public transportation employees, mediated by the roles of GHRM policies and knowledge. The study suggests that public transportation companies can enhance employee engagement and environmental impact by developing plans to foster a sense of belonging and environmental responsibility among their workforce. The research highlights the importance of aligning organizational policies with individual behavior to achieve environmental sustainability goals. The study also emphasizes the need for effective leadership and well-defined procedures to implement environmentally conscious business strategies. Additionally, it underscores the role of human resource management in promoting a sustainable culture within organizations.
